Amendments of the Navigation (Survey) Regulations 

Survey authorities.

1. Regulation 5 of the Navigation (Survey) Regulations is amended by adding at the end thereof the following sub-regulation:—

“(4.) Det norske Veritas is a prescribed association for the survey and registry of shipping.”.

Classification certificates.

2. Regulation 6 of the Navigation (Survey) Regulations is amended by adding at the end thereof the following sub-regulations:—

“(4.) A class 1A1 classification certificate issued by Det norske Veritas, other than a certificate on which the characters 1A1, MV or KV appear without being preceded by the mark ✠ or the mark ✠, is a classification certificate of a prescribed standard.

“(5.) A classification certificate issued by Det norske Veritas in respect of a ship shall not be taken to be a class 1A1 classification certificate by reason of it bearing the characters 1A1 if it also bears characters or characters and words that indicate that the ship is intended to be put into service within specified waters only.”.
